Remarks

Eligibility criteria are simply like any other college admission process. Just apply in JoSSA and fill out the college names as per your rank and requirement. This is the most crucial step if you ask me, I made a mistake while choosing filling by not numbering the colleges that I desired the most. Also, remember to fill every college if you have zero expectations that you'll get a seat there because there is no limit in the choice filling. I already got this college in my 3rd round in JoSSA counseling but I was waiting for any improvement in my next round so I chose the 'slide' option while I did my document verification in my nearest NIT which is VNIT, Nagpur. But sadly, didn't get any NIT, so then I opted for CSAB in which your AIR rank is used to determine the college you'll get and again I got this same college (feels like this was written in my destiny) Anything regarding this college can be found on their official website:- www.nitsri.ac.in

Course Curriculum Overview

3.5

Chose this course because this was the one I filled and got too. Also, this course is the best highlight of NIT, Srinagar. Faculties are great supportive. They'll help you out with everything if you are seeking help. I only gave my 1st sem paper in my college the rest of all semesters were in online mode due to covid-19. The paper difficulty level was moderate: not that easy but not that hard too. Faculty members are nicely qualified and their teaching method is also very interactive.

Fees and Financial Aid

Fee Structure can be understood by visiting their official website which is www.nitsri.ac.in I got a reservation so I only need to pay for my mess and hostel fees which is a considerable amount. But if you Belong to any other caste then you'll get a fee waiver only if your income is below 5 l.p.a ( during my time this was the limit) else you need to pay the course fees too. Hostel Facilities

3.5

Hostel rooms will have great illuminance light, study table, beds, cupboard. The rest of the things you need to buy according to your need/requirement. Meal quality is better not to say anything about it what can you expect from the mess food, everywhere the same thing. Registration is quite simple. Just fill out the form. Pay the fees and you are all good to go.
